11548 sujets

JavaScript, DOM et API Web HTML5

bonjour,

dans l'un de mes scripts, j'ai besoin de redéfinir dynamiquement la propriété 'line-height', seulement un:
setStyle($('mon_element'), line-height: this.K*this.ma_valeur+'px');

ne semble pas fonctionner Smiley ohwell

Je suspecte la propriété 'line-height' de s'écrire différemment ds le contexte de la fonction setStyle(), comme c'est le cas pour 'text-align' qui s'écrit alors 'textAlign' d'après cette référence

J'ai beau essayer différentes combinaisons:
- lineHeight
- 'line-height'

, rien n'y fait et impossible de trouver une doc convenable sur le net au sujet des équivalents 'cssPropertyHash'

Je m'en remet donc à vos bons soins et votre grande expertise Smiley biggrin

d'avance merci

to
Modifié par wouf (05 Nov 2006 - 22:22)
Modérateur
Bonjour,

Element.setStyle( 'mon_element', { lineHeight: this.K * this.ma_valeur + 'px' } );
peut-être...

@+
c'est exactement ça: lineHeight Smiley smile

j'avais dû le taper trop vite Smiley murf , merci en tout cas, voilà qui fonctionne à présent Smiley ravi

to